When to test after a risk
This matters more than how soon you can be seen. Testing too early gives a result that reassures you wrongly. The Early Detection panel is for less than 10 days since the exposure, the Complete panel for after 10 days, and HIV testing is reliable from 28 days. If you come in too early we will tell you, and tell you when to come back.

What we test for IN CAMBRIDGE
- STI Early Detection, £295. For less than 10 days since exposure. Chlamydia trachomatis, gonorrhoea, syphilis, herpes simplex I and II, mycoplasma hominis and genitalium, ureaplasma urealyticum, bacterial vaginosis and haemophilus ducreyi.
- STI Complete, £495. For after 10 days. HIV, hepatitis B and C, chlamydia, gonorrhoea, syphilis, herpes simplex I and II, ureaplasma and mycoplasma, trichomonas and gardnerella.
- HIV test, £195. Reliable from 28 days after exposure. HIV antibody and p24 antigen.


What happens after your results IN CAMBRIDGE
Results come back the next day, and someone talks you through them.
- If everything is negative, we will tell you whether the timing of your test means it can be relied on, or whether one marker needs repeating later.
- If something is positive, most infections we test for are straightforward to treat, and we treat them here. Chlamydia is a short antibiotic course. Gonorrhoea needs an intramuscular injection and a test of cure afterwards. Syphilis and HIV need specialist care, and we arrange the referral rather than leaving you to find it.
- Partner notification is part of the conversation, not an afterthought. We will help you work out who needs telling and how, including anonymously.
